Mohamed Barry

Member Details

Mohamed Barry advises clients on their most complex employment and labor issues. Specializing in traditional labor matters involving collective bargaining, union organizing, arbitrations, and strikes, Mohamed has successfully defended employers in court, mediation, and administrative proceedings.

Mohamed advises clients to help them comply with laws and regulations affecting the workplace and provides guidance on various employment law matters. He conducts workplace investigations and trains management on a range of issues, including union avoidance, Equal Employment Opportunity Act compliance, and DEI.

Before joining DWT, Mohamed practiced employment and labor law in New Jersey and Pennsylvania. He previously served as a deputy attorney general in New Jersey, where he prosecuted trials and handled hearings and arguments in state Superior Court, including at the appellate level.

He was selected as a member of the 2022 Class for Leadership Newark's Public Policy Fellows, a two-year program dedicated to building stronger communities through activism and civic engagement. He has written and edited for various publications, including Law360 and Developing Labor Law.
